Case 550g Bulldozer Roller Options and Compatibility Checklist for Buyers

How to Choose the Right Roller Case

When you’re sourcing a replacement, the most important step is matching the roller case to your machine configuration. Start by confirming the exact model family and the way the undercarriage is set up—rollers, frame alignment, and track type must work together. A correct fit helps prevent uneven wear, reduces stress on mounting case 550g bulldozer rollers points, and supports consistent travel over rough ground. If you’re upgrading as well as replacing, compare the operating conditions you face (abrasive soil, wet or muddy surfaces, frequent turns, or long straight runs) and select components designed to hold up under those loads.

What to Look For in Roller Quality

Buyer confidence comes from understanding build features, not just appearance. Look for roller cases with robust construction, stable geometry, and bearings/fitment intended to resist contamination. Since roller performance directly affects how the track carries weight, poor quality parts can contribute to accelerated tracking issues and caterpillar rubber tracks inconsistent contact. Also check surface finish and sealing strategy, because debris and moisture can quickly damage internal components. If you’re replacing multiple items, choose a consistent quality level across rollers and related undercarriage hardware to maintain predictable performance.

Before purchase, inspect current wear patterns: cupped or feathered edges, abnormal tension marks, or signs of shifting can indicate roller mismatch or internal wear. Measure alignment where possible and evaluate whether your track is staying centered under load. If your track shows irregular wear, don’t assume it’s only a track problem—rollers often drive the motion and contact behavior that cause premature tracking damage. Selecting the right roller case can help restore smooth movement and improve undercarriage life.
